The basic systematic procedure that can be followed in the identification of environmental health hazards involves answering several key questions. These questions include:
1. What is the nature of the hazard?
2. What is the level of the hazard?
3. What is the duration of the exposure?
4. What is the source of the hazard?
5. What is the pathway of exposure?
6. What is the magnitude of the hazard?
7. What is the potential for human exposure?
8. What is the extent of the hazard?
9. What is the susceptibility of the population?
10. What is the significance of the hazard to the population?
11. What is the best method for minimizing the hazard?
When identifying environmental health hazards, it is important to understand the nature of the hazard, such as whether it is a chemical, biological, or physical hazard. Assessing the level of the hazard helps determine the severity of its impact on human health. The duration of exposure is crucial to understand the potential long-term effects of the hazard.
Identifying the source of the hazard involves determining where it originates from, whether it is from industrial processes, pollution sources, or natural occurrences. The pathway of exposure examines how humans come into contact with the hazard, such as through ingestion, inhalation, or direct contact.
Assessing the magnitude of the hazard involves understanding the concentration or amount of the hazardous substance present in the environment. Evaluating the potential for human exposure helps determine how likely individuals are to come into contact with the hazard.
Understanding the extent of the hazard involves determining the geographic range or distribution of the hazard and its potential impact on a population. Considering the susceptibility of the population helps identify groups that may be more vulnerable to the hazard, such as children, the elderly, or individuals with compromised immune systems.
Evaluating the significance of the hazard to the population involves assessing the overall impact on public health and considering factors such as the number of people affected and the severity of health effects. Finally, determining the best method for minimizing the hazard involves developing strategies to reduce exposure, implement control measures, and promote preventive actions.

the hipaa security rule was enacted specifically to provide guidelines for the
The HIPAA Security Rule was enacted specifically to provide guidelines for the protection of electronic protected health information (e-PHI).
The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) is a federal law that sets standards for the privacy and security of patients' health information. The Security Rule, which is a part of HIPAA, focuses on safeguarding e-PHI. It establishes guidelines and requirements for covered entities (healthcare providers, health plans, and healthcare clearinghouses) and their business associates to maintain the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of e-PHI. The rule covers administrative, technical, and physical safeguards to ensure the protection of electronic health information.
In summary, the HIPAA Security Rule plays a crucial role in protecting patients' electronic health information by setting guidelines for healthcare organizations and their business associates. This helps maintain the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of e-PHI, ensuring the privacy and security of patients' sensitive data.

Patients experiencing dysuria and hematuria, two common symptoms of urinary tract infection (UTI), may be in need of medical attention. Dysuria is characterized by pain during urination, while hematuria is characterized by the presence of blood in the urine.
Other symptoms of UTI may include frequent urination, urgency to urinate, and cloudy or foul-smelling urine. If left untreated, UTI can cause serious complications, such as kidney damage. Treatment for UTI usually involves antibiotics, but other treatments may be needed depending on the severity of the infection.
To reduce the risk of UTI recurrence, drinking plenty of fluids and practicing good hygiene is important. If you experience any of the abovementioned symptoms, it is important to seek medical attention.
